The Magic of Vallenato: Why It's Perfect for Love

So, what's the deal with vallenato and why does it have this incredible power to express love? Vallenato, originating from Colombia, is more than just music; it's a storytelling art form. Its roots lie deep in the cultural heart of the Caribbean coast, where stories of life, love, and loss are woven into every melody. The combination of the accordion, caja vallenata (a small drum), and guacharaca (a scraper) creates a unique sound that is both intimate and incredibly danceable. This unique blend of instruments provides the perfect background for the heartfelt lyrics, which often speak directly to the soul.

A Bit of History: The Soul of Vallenato

Let's take a quick trip back in time to understand the soul of this beautiful genre. Vallenato's origins can be traced back to the late 19th and early 20th centuries in the Valledupar region of Colombia. Initially, it was a music of the people, played by troubadours who would travel from town to town, sharing stories and serenading their audience. These early vallenatos were simple, often improvised, and focused on everyday life and local events. The accordion, brought to the region by European immigrants, became the heart and soul of the music, and the songs developed a unique sound. You will love this journey through time.

Over time, vallenato evolved. The songs became more structured, and the lyrics more sophisticated. The music began to incorporate influences from other genres, like the son and merengue. The stories they told evolved as well, and love became a central theme. The troubadours became popular figures, and their songs spread throughout Colombia and beyond. Then, the Golden Age of Vallenato arrived. In the mid-20th century, artists like Rafael Escalona and Alejo Durán helped to popularize the genre, recording albums and performing on radio and television. These pioneers laid the groundwork for the modern vallenato that we know today. Their contribution to the genre has been very important.

Today, vallenato remains a vital part of Colombian culture, with many new artists keeping the tradition alive. These songs have a very strong character and are ideal for dedicating and enjoying.
